~ it went on well and
| reached the ubuntu desktop and it read that nautilus has quit
| unexpectedly and so whther i need to inform or start once again. i
| followed and link where it said i could type "apt-get dist-upgrade" but
| it said i had no permission and asked me if i am root. i am not very
| familiar with linux os or the commands. but still could i type in
| something like "su" if so wat would be the password
cant use su on ubuntu. use sudo then the command you want after it like
" sudo apt-get install" or sudo -s for a root prompt. the root password
is what you typed in for root password when you installed ubuntu. thats
why it says when it asks you for the password during installation "make
sure you remember this password"
